3 Wheel Pushchairs
If you're a keen athlete or just looking for a more versatile stroller 3 wheel pushchairs offer everything. Three-wheel prams, that have air-filled tires instead of the big wheels that are often found on jogging buggies designed for paved roads, can be used to navigate through woodland trails or cobbled streets.
Certain models are heavy and heavy due to their massive wheels. Make sure they fold down in a compact manner and don't occupy your entire boot space.
Stability
Many parents are turned off by three wheel pushchairs by stories of them tipping over, but this is often down to poor quality or poorly designed models. It is important to test the stability of a 3-wheeler by putting it through its paces. You should also look at how easy it is to change direction or swerve using the single front wheel, and how quickly it can be done.
If you plan to use your pushchair on uneven terrain, you should choose an option that has air-filled tires (also called pneumatic tyres). They can handle the bumps and lumps that come with gravel tracks or muddy paths. These tyres are more resistant to bumps and sand on muddy paths or gravel roads than the plastic wheels. They provide a more comfortable ride for your baby. Some models come with an lockable wheel on the front that can be used on rough terrain.
All-terrain pushchairs are heavier than standard four-wheeled buggies and you'll need to think about the amount of room they will take up in your car's boot and if you'll be capable of lifting it up and down stairs when folded. They can also be heavy to lift and carry, so try one in person if possible to see how much effort you'll have to put into lifting the buggy off the ground.
UPPAbaby's Ridge, a three-wheeled pram with a car-seat attachment, is an excellent example of a stable, manoeuvrable pram. It has a world-facing seat that can be connected to a UPPAbaby carrycot or you can also add infant car seats by using adaptors. Its large rear wheels have foam-filled tyres that are never flat, which make it easy to navigate rough terrain. The smooth suspension and adjustable handlebar ensure that your toddler or baby will be comfortable.
Manoeuvrability
With two wheels at the back and a single wheel at the front, best 3 wheel buggy wheel pushchairs can move and turn more easily than 4-wheeled pushchairs. They are perfect for navigating narrow city streets and crowded supermarket aisles. A majority of 3-wheel strollers come with locks on the front wheel, which makes it easier to maneuver around tight corners.
A pushchair with three wheels can perform better on off-road terrain than standard prams and strollers. For example, iCandy's core has a variety of features that make this pushchair ideal for countryside adventures. It has a rural wheelbase with larger wheels that, according to MFM reviewer Tara, "perform really well on woodland tracks, grass and cobbles from markets."
In addition to their outstanding mobility, 3 wheel pushchairs are usually designed for durability. They're often equipped with suspension systems that can absorb the bumps and shocks of different surfaces, making sure that your baby will remain comfortable throughout their journeys. This makes them an excellent choice for families that enjoy being outdoors but do not want to sacrifice convenience or comfort.
lightweight 3 wheel pushchair wheel pushchairs can also be used as joggers too, although you'll have to wait until your child is 6 or 9 months old before you start running with them (unless you have an infant carrier). Bugaboo's Sport Verso is a world-first that offers an innovative modular system that allows you to transport your child from infant to toddler using an infant car seat and a carrycot compatible with the chassis. You can even switch between a run mode and stroll mode, so you can go from woodland walks to a relaxing shopping trip without difficulty.

Off-road
Many pushchairs that are used for regular use struggle with bumpy terrain like rocky paths, cobbles and tree roots. However, best 3 wheel pushchair-wheeled buggies are much more able to handle these types of terrain. Typically these models come with larger rear wheels and often have a lockable front wheel that can also rotate to navigate through difficult terrain. This feature means that you can swiftly slip into and out of small gaps, take difficult kerbs without difficulty and keep control even on tougher routes.
All-terrain pushchairs are a great choice for families who enjoy spending time outdoors and would like to explore the countryside or go off-road for family walks. These models come with large puncture-proof tires as well as suspension, making them more able to withstand rough surfaces. They also provide an easy ride for your child. The UPPAbaby Ridge, for example, has an impressive range of off-road capabilities. It's designed to handle all kinds of terrain, and comes with a world-facing seat and car seat adaptor. It also has large tyres that are filled with foam so you don't need to worry about punctures.
Other strollers that are all-terrain include the Out n About Nipper. It is suitable for babies starting at birth, using a newborn carrier or lie-flat infant carriers. It is equipped with a range of off-road features, such as an adjustable swivel wheel lockable as well as air-filled tyres and suspension. When your baby is older, it's suitable for jogging lightly. The Bugaboo Fox 5 all-terrain stroller is also a popular option. It is suitable for everyday use or for pushing off roads because of its sturdy chassis and impressive suspension. It also comes with a swivel front wheel, large basket, one-handed fold, and an adjustable handlebar.
